Spaghetti Sauce From Fresh Tomatoes Recipe

If you love pasta, you know that the sauce can make or break the dish. And while store-bought spaghetti sauce is convenient, nothing beats the taste of homemade sauce made from fresh tomatoes. Making spaghetti sauce from scratch may seem daunting at first, but it's actually quite easy, and the end result is well worth the effort.

Ingredients:

For this recipe, you'll need:

  • 10-12 medium-sized fresh tomatoes
  • 1 onion, diced
  • 4 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 1/4 cup of ol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on of salt
  • 1 teaspoon of sugar
  • 1/4 teaspoon of black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on of red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 1/4 cup of fresh basil, chopped

Spaghetti Sauce Ingredients

Instructions:

1. Start by washing and chopping the tomatoes. You can use a food processor to chop them quickly and easily, or you can do it by hand if you prefer a chunkier sauce.

Chopped Tomatoes

2.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the diced onion and cook until it's soft and translucent, about 5-7 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ook for an additional 30 seconds.

Cooking Onion And Garlic

3. Add the chopped tomatoes to the pot and stir to combine. Add the salt, sugar, black pepper, and red pepper flakes (if using) and stir again.

Adding Tomatoes To Pot

4. Bring the sauce to a simmer and let it cook for about 45 minutes to an hour, stirring occasionally. The longer you let it cook, the thicker and richer the sauce will become.

Simmering Sauce

5. Once the sauce has cooked down to your desired consistency, remove it from the heat and let it cool slightly. Use an immersion blender or transfer the sauce to a blender or food processor and blend until it's smooth.

Blending Sauce

6. Finally, stir in the chopped basil and taste the sauce. Adjust the seasoning as needed, adding more salt, sugar, or spices to taste.

Adding Basil To Sauce

Conclusion:

That's it – your homemade spaghetti sauce from fresh tomatoes is ready to serve! Spoon it over your favorite pasta, add some grated Parmesan cheese, and enjoy. This recipe makes enough sauce for about 8 servings, so you can freeze any leftovers for later use. With this recipe, you'll never go back to store-bought sauce again!
